Made in the famous, Tsubame-Sanjo district our Yukihira Stainless Steel Pan is the perfect addition to any kitchenware series. The Tsubame-Sanjo district is known for its craftsmanship and metal processing of cutlery, tableware, cooking tools, etc., and produces world-class products.
